20100120911 | PRESERVATIVE SYSTEM FOR COSMETIC FORMULATIONS - Disclosed is a novel method for preserving cosmetic/personal care formulations through a two component preservative system, said system comprising (a) Component I which functions to eliminate the existing microbial contamination load in a natural cosmetic formulation base through an optimized pasteurization method that avoids deep freezing; and (b) Component II that includes the step of adding synergistic blends of fractionated essential oils, extracts and isolated compounds to the pre-pasteurized cosmetic base obtained through the method of component I, wherein the synergistic blends sustain the effects of pasteurization through anti-microbial and anti-oxidant effects, said anti-oxidant effects enhancing further the anti-microbial effects by virtue of inhibiting lipid per oxidation that facilitates the undue proliferation of microbe. | 05-13-2010 |
20100240767 | Melanogenesis inhibitiuon by 3,5-dimethoxy-4'-hydroxystilbenes and cosmeceutical compositions thereof - Disclosed is the cosmeceutical potential of 3,5-dimethoxy-4′-hydroxystilbene in terms of its melanogenesis inhibitory and photo protective activities. Also disclosed does a topical melanogenesis inhibitory composition comprising 0.01 to 50% by weight of 3,5-dimethoxy-4′-hydroxystilbene. | 09-23-2010 |

20140303258 | Method of solubilizing insoluble bioactive compounds using triterpene glycosides and compositions thereof - Disclosed are the uses of triterpene glycosides as non-toxic natural solubilizing agents for bioactive compounds and/or metabolites thereof. Triterpene glycosides are also shown to solubilize insoluble natural extracts. Also disclosed are exemplary methods and compositions incorporating the uses of triterpene glycosides as non-toxic natural solubilizing agents. | 10-09-2014 |
